Arsenal in transfer battle with Manchester United for South American sensation
Arsenal are battling Manchester United for signing South American talent Maxi Araujo this summer.
The Gunners boss Mikel Arteta has been left impressed with the forward’s performances in the Champions League.
Arsenal have moved ahead of their Manchester rivals as they have made contact with the player’s representatives, per Portuguese outlet Record.
The Gunners want to add a quality new winger, with Gabriel Martinelli or Leandro Trossard expected to be sold.
Araujo has mainly operated as a left-back this season, but he is also capable of playing on the left wing.
Araujo has been earning rave reviews with his performances in Portugal since joining Sporting Lisbon in 2024.
He has made 41 appearances across all competitions this season, scoring six goals and creating four assists in the process.
He has averaged 1.4 shots, 1.1 key passes, 4.0 ball recoveries and 1.8 tackles per game in the Primeira Liga.
Araujo has an €80 million release clause in his contract, but that is simply to protect the player’s transfer value and Sporting are ready to sell him for €60m.
Arsenal also face competition from United, who are also keen on the Uruguayan.
The Red Devils spent most of their transfer budget to upgrade their attack last summer.
